Volunteers in Turkey have placed red balloons on the ruins of destroyed buildings to remind children who died in the ruins following the February 6th devastating earthquake.
Guided by pictures of Og Sever Ocur, they climbed to the ruins of Hatay and attached balloons to metal wires that emerged from piles of ruins.
Over 45,000 people have died in southern Turkey and northern Syria.
